The detection of high impedance fault on electrical system has been one of the most difficult problem. A New approach was developed to estimate the fault location in High - voltage power transmission lines quickly and accurately by using support vector machines (SVM) and wavelet transform of measured voltage and current signals. In which fault current and voltage signal obtained are decompose by Wavelet Transform (WT). As data set increase in size, their analysis become more complicated and time consuming. Discrete Wavelet transform is used for signal preprocessing. Initially the features of the line currents are extracted by first level decomposition of the current samples using discrete wavelet transform (DWT). Subsequently, the extracted features are applied as inputs to a SVM for determining the fault zone.
